Key Meanings and Concepts



To comprehend the differences in between Surety Contract bonds and insurance coverage, it's necessary to grasp key definitions and ideas.

Surety Contract bonds are a three-party contract where the guaranty ensures the Performance of a legal obligation by the principal to the obligee. The principal is the celebration that gets the bond, the obligee is the party that requires the bond, and the surety is the party that guarantees the Performance.

Insurance coverage, on the other hand, is a two-party agreement where the insurer agrees to compensate the insured for specified losses or damages for the settlement of premiums.

Unlike insurance policy, Surety Contract bonds don't give economic protection to the principal. Rather, they supply guarantee to the obligee that the principal will meet their contractual commitments.

Sorts Of Protection Offered



Now allow's check out the various sorts of protection offered in Surety Contract bonds and insurance coverage.

When it concerns surety Contract bonds, there are 2 main types of protection to think about:

- ** Performance Bonds **: These bonds supply economic protection to the task owner in case the service provider stops working to complete the task as set. If the professional defaults or fails to satisfy the terms of the Contract, the Performance bond makes certain that the project owner is made up for any kind of financial losses sustained.

On the other hand, insurance coverage normally supplies insurance coverage in the form of plans for numerous threats, such as residential property damages, responsibility, or personal injury. Insurance policies provide financial defense in case of unanticipated mishaps or losses.
